South Carolina Man Indicted for Misuse of an Agency Seal and Falsifying an FAA Letter
On July 11, 2017, Jeffery M. Patterson was indicted in U.S. District Court, Greenville, South Carolina, for false statements, misuse of an agency seal, and aggravated identity theft.
The charges stem from a DOT-OIG investigation into allegations that Patterson falsified a letter that was purportedly issued by FAA and falsely represented that he held various FAA certifications, including an Airframe and Power Plant Mechanic’s certificate and an inspection authorization.
Note: Indictments, informations, and criminal complaints are only accusations by the Government. All defendants are presumed innocent unless and until proven guilty.
